Jacket heat exchanger is a kind of inter wall heat exchanger

Author:wubaiyi    Time:2021-02-20

Jacket type heat exchanger is a kind of inter wall heat exchanger. It is made of jacket installed on the outer wall of the vessel and has simple structure; However, the heating surface is limited by the wall of the vessel, and the heat transfer coefficient is not high. In order to improve the heat transfer coefficient and make the liquid in the kettle heated evenly, the agitator can be installed in the kettle. When the jacket is filled with cooling water or heating agent without phase change, the spiral baffle or other measures to increase turbulence can be set in the jacket to improve the heat transfer coefficient on one side of the jacket. In order to supplement the lack of heat transfer surface, the snake tube can also be installed inside the kettle. Jacket heat exchanger is widely used for heating and cooling of reaction process. Jacketed heat exchanger is mainly used in the reactor. It is installed outside the reactor to form a closed interlayer, which makes the fluid enter into the interlayer and conduct heat exchange with the materials in the reactor through the wall. The structure of the jacket heat exchanger is relatively simple, which can carry out heat exchange at the same time of material reaction, and saves the trouble of setting up another heat exchange equipment. The disadvantages of the jacket heat exchanger are that the heat transfer surface of the jacket is not large, the jacket gap is narrow, the fluid flow velocity is small, and the heat transfer coefficient is not high. Jacketed heat exchanger is mainly used to control the reaction temperature and pressure in the reactor by steam heating or cold water cooling. Because the inside of the jacket can not be cleaned, it is not suitable for the medium with fouling and dirt to enter the jacket. It should be noted that the reactor with jacket heat exchange is an internal pressure vessel because its outer cylinder is affected by the medium pressure in the jacket; The inner cylinder belongs to the external pressure vessel, so the pressure of Jacket Medium must be controlled in the production process. If the pressure exceeds the allowable value, the inner cylinder of reactor may lose stability and be compressed, resulting in equipment damage.
